*
* Partitions are required so that Badblock management (inc spare blocks), FlashFS (Blackbox Logging), Configuration and Firmware can be kept separate and tracked.
*
* Currently, to keep things simple (and working), the following rules apply:
*
* 1) order of partitions in the paritions table strictly defined as follows
*
* BAD BLOCK MANAGEMENT
* FIRMWARE
* FLASH FS
*
* 2) If firmware or bootloader doesn't use or care about a particular type partition the corresponding entry should be empty, i.e. partition table entry memset to 0x00.
*
* 3) flash FS must start at sector 0. IMPORTANT: There is existing blackbox/flash FS code the relies on this!!!
* XXX FIXME
* XXX Note that Flash FS must start at sector 0.
* XXX There is existing blackbox/flash FS code the relies on this!!!
* XXX This restriction can and will be fixed by creating a set of flash operation functions that take partition as an additional parameter.
*/
